We would call ourselves more of a bar who serves great food than a restaurant with a bar! This isn’t just another Mexican Restaurant with beans and rice. Chimichanga Llama is a fun and eclectic Latin-inspired Cantina with tastes and flavors from all over Central and South America. Garage doors provide an open air feel inside the Cantina. Ocean views and breezes from our wrap around outside deck and patio make for el fresco dining and drinking perfection. We offer live entertainment, two bars serving signature cocktails and colorful plates of fresh, delicious food.
